THE MAN CARD DRILL EXPLAINED.

In the last 3 going on 4 years only 65 MAN CARDS (short cards)have been earned in the wild. The Short Card is your admission to attempt the Long Card.

The “Man Card” Drill is a series of performance on demand standards based on first round accountability to be done cold both rifle & pistol. These standards are demanding and require a proficient shooter to execute each iteration with sound fundamentals! Anyone can come to achieve this standard without the pressure that exists when doing it at one of my courses.
The stress and pressure is another added variable to show shooters where they may be falling short in their training so that they can exploit their own weakness. The stress experienced doesn’t even compare to the stress experienced in a shooting or a gunfight but it definitely opens some eyes.

"MAN CARD" Drill starts off with Czone size steel or you can use a clean IPSC target and only count the Czone hits.

Distance: 25yrds

Target: Czone steel or IPSC Czone.

Ammo/Equipment: Partimer, 1 Full pistol Mag, 1 Full Rifle Mag & 1 Empty Rifle Mag to set up the Transition from Rifle to Pistol.

Course of fire: (short card)
1 round Pistol from compressed ready. Par time 1 sec.

1 round Pistol from holster. Par time 1.5 sec.

1 round Rifle from low ready. Par time 1 sec. (45* downward cover)

1 round Rifle from high ready. Par time 1 sec. (out of shoulder)

1 round Rifle from either ready position, transition to pistol, 1 round Pistol. Par time 2.5 sec.

All hits must be recorded. You can limit attempts to 2 or for standard only give each shooter 1 chance. Again this is normally shot from a cold shooter status.

Any shots out of the Czone = failure
Any shots over time = failure.
